Zlata (from the Bulgarian word "zlato" meaning - gold) was a simple girl living in small Bulgarian village in 18 century. Her beauty was extraordinary. At the time Bulgaria was under Ottoman occupation (which lasted 500 years). One of the Turkish leaders of the village wanted Zlata for his wife. That meant she had to give her faith, she was of very strong character and refused to do it. Her own family begged her, for her own sake to marry him. When the oppressors found themselves helpless, they tortured and at the end hanged Zlata. She died for her strong believes and thus was later proclaimed a saint.

This piece is a traditional icon, painted with tempera on wood, decorated with golden leaf.
